Overview

2720
After a violent police raid in a poor clandestine neighbourhood in Lisbon, a 7-year-old girl seeks to find her missing older brother. At the same time, a young newly released ex-convict tries to start anew, free from a life of crime. The fate of these two will cross in the worst way.

DIRECTOR BIOGRAPHY - Basil Da Cunha
Swiss director of Portuguese origin, Basil da Cunha was born in 1985. Alongside his studies in political science and sociology, he made several self-produced short films before co-founding Thera Production. In 2009, he began his film training at the Head University in Geneva. In his first year, Basil made the film “A Côté”, which was nominated for the Prix du Cinéma Suisse 2010 and awarded the Best National Film Award at Curtas Vila do Conde IFF. SUNFISH (2011) e OS VIVOS TAMBÉM CHORAM (2012) were presented at the Quinzaine des Cinéastes. Encouraged by the special mention of the Quinzaine des Cinéastes jury and numerous international awards, he made his first feature film AFTER THE NIGHT (2013), which had its world premiere at the Quinzaine des Cinéastes. The film was also shown at the São Paulo IFF and at the Locarno FF. Basil gave a first workshop in the Film Department, Haute École D’art et de Design – Geneva (HEAD), before joining the team in 2013 on a permanent basis. Basil da Cunha directed NUVEM NEGRA (2014), an experimental film within the framework of the Biennale of the Moving Image (Geneva). THE END OF THE WORLD (2019) had its world premiere in Locarno FF and was screened at other prestigious festivals, such as Busan IFF, Milan FF and São Paulo IFF. It was awarded at Les Arcs and Valladolid before winning Best Cinematography at the Prix du Cinéma Suisse in 2020. 2720 (2023) was selected for Visions du Réel and Curtas Vila do Conde IFF. His latest work is MANGA D'TERRA (2023), selected at the Locarno FF.
